PYRAZOLE-QUINAZOLINE HYBRIDS AS POTENT ANTIMICROBIAL AND ANTHELMINTIC ACTIVITY: DESIGN, SYNTHESIS, CHARACTERIZATION
A. Jyothsna* and K. Padma Latha
. Abstract In the design of novel drugs, the formation of hybrid molecules via the combination of several pharmacophores can give rise to compounds with interesting biochemical profiles. A series of novel Prazole- Quinazoline hybrids (7a-7j) were synthesized, characterized and evaluated for their in vitro antimicrobial and anthelmintic activities. All compounds, were synthesized through four steps method and structurally evaluated by FTIR, 1H-NMR and Mass spectroscopy. In order to evaluate the biological activities, the synthesized hybrid compounds were studied for in vitro antibacterial activity against three Staphylococcus aureus, Bacillus subtilis (Gram positive) and Escherichia coli, Klebsiella pneumonia (Gram negative) and also, Aspergillus niger, Aspergillus tevatus, Pencillium notatum like fungi strain. Among the synthesized compounds 7c, 7e and 7h showed good antibacterial, antifungal and anthelmintic activities.
